AJA
The new firmware v3.0 for the Ki Pro GO multi-channel H.264 recorder and player features several expanded network-based recording options and support for SMB protocols via GigE network connectivity.
Ki Pro GO now features powerful new network storage support to improve workflow flexibility and expand recording options, such as simultaneous recording to local USB drives, while network storage offers versatile options for primary and archival recording for a variety of production scenarios, including live events and sports broadcasts.
Ki Pro GO is AJA's H.264 multi-channel portable recorder, offering up to 4 channels of simultaneous HD and SD recording to affordable out-of-the-box media or new network-based storage. Ki Pro GO v3.0 allows any channel to be recorded directly to network-attached storage (NAS) via the built-in GigE port, regardless of local USB storage.
